Maximizing Integration with Custom API Management
The Importance of API Management
In today’s digital age, businesses rely heavily on technology to streamline processes, enhance customer experiences, and drive innovation. Application Programming Interfaces (APIs) play a crucial role in enabling seamless communication and integration between various software applications. However, with the increasing complexity and number of APIs, organizations must have a robust API management strategy in place. For a more complete learning experience, we recommend visiting Bespoke API Software. You’ll discover more pertinent details about the discussed topic.
Choosing the Right API Management Solution
Implementing an effective API management solution requires careful consideration and evaluation of different options available in the market. Some key factors to consider when choosing a custom API management solution include:
Customizing API Management for Seamless Integration
While off-the-shelf API management solutions can be useful, organizations often have unique requirements that demand customized features and functionalities. Custom API management allows businesses to tailor the solution to their specific needs, ensuring seamless integration with existing systems and maximizing efficiency. Here are some tips to maximize integration with custom API management:
1. Identify Integration Needs
Start by identifying your organization’s integration needs. Consider the systems and applications you currently use and the goals you want to achieve through integration. Determine the specific functionalities and features that will streamline workflows and Get informed improve overall efficiency.
2. Define Integration Processes
Once you have identified your integration needs, define the integration processes and workflows. This involves mapping out how information flows between systems and the desired outcomes of each integration. Clearly define the inputs, outputs, and any transformations or validations required during the integration process.
3. Customize API Endpoints
Custom API management allows you to define and customize API endpoints based on your integration needs. This involves specifying the method, URL, and parameters necessary for data exchange between systems. By customizing endpoints, you can ensure seamless integration with existing systems and avoid conflicts or inconsistencies.
4. Implement Security Measures
Security is a critical aspect of API management. When customizing your API management solution, prioritize the implementation of robust security measures. These may include implementing access controls, encryption, and authentication mechanisms to protect sensitive data and prevent unauthorized access.
5. Consider Data Mapping and Transformation
Depending on the systems being integrated, data mapping and transformation may be necessary to ensure compatibility and consistency. Custom API management solutions allow you to define data mapping rules and transformations to ensure seamless data exchange between systems.
6. Leverage Analytics and Monitoring
Analyzing API usage and performance is essential for identifying bottlenecks and optimizing integration. Custom API management solutions often provide advanced analytics and monitoring capabilities, allowing organizations to track API usage, monitor response times, and identify potential issues.
The Benefits of Custom API Management
By customizing your API management solution, you can experience several benefits: Learn more about the topic in this external resource we’ve prepared for you. Bespoke Software UK.
Conclusion
Custom API management is essential for maximizing integration and achieving seamless communication between systems. By identifying integration needs, customizing endpoints, implementing security measures, and leveraging analytics, organizations can optimize their API management strategy. With the right custom API management solution in place, businesses can streamline processes, enhance customer experiences, and drive innovation in today’s digital landscape.



